#cc9785 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c9785 is composed of 80% red, 59.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 41% and a lightness of 66.1%. #cc9785 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#992f0b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#cc9785 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cc9785 has RGB values of R:204, G:151,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.35,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13408133.

Shades and Tints of #cc9785

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c9785

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ba7a6 is the less saturated color, while #fb8056 is the most saturated one.
